The Home Depot Store locator Scottsboro

The Home Depot stores located in Scottsboro: 1

The Home Depot store locator Scottsboro displays complete list and huge database of The Home Depot stores, factory stores, shops and boutiques in Scottsboro (Alabama). The Home Depot information: map of Scottsboro, shopping hours, contact information.

The Home Depot stores in Scottsboro, Alabama on Map

The Home Depot stores in Scottsboro, Alabama on Map

The Home Depot store locations in Scottsboro (Alabama)

More The Home Depot stores in Alabama - AL

Search all The Home Depot stores located in Scottsboro, Alabama

Specify The Home Depot store location:

Go to the city The Home Depot locator